首頁  >  文章  >  後端開發  >  為自訂 PHP 函數新增文件註解有什麼好處?

為自訂 PHP 函數新增文件註解有什麼好處?

王林
王林原創
2024-04-22 11:39:02574瀏覽

新增文件註解到自訂 PHP 函數的好處包括:提高程式碼可讀性和可維護性,讓他人更容易了解函數的功能。啟用 IDE 智慧提示和自動補全,加快開發速度。提供測試用例基礎,確保函數符合預期。範例:/*** 計算兩數的總和 * @param int $number1 第一個數字 * @param int $number2 第二個數字 * @return int 兩個數字的總和*/

为自定义 PHP 函数添加文档注释有什么好处?

為自訂PHP 函數新增文件註解的好處

##文件註解是附加到函數或類別中的特殊註釋,用於提供有關其功能和如何使用的資訊。在自訂PHP 函數中新增文件註解有很多好處,包括:

1. 程式碼可讀性和可維護性

文件註解使你的程式碼更容易閱讀和理解,特別是對於其他開發人員。清晰的文件有助於記錄函數的用途、參數和傳回值,從而減少混亂和錯誤。

2. IDE 智慧提示和自動補全

許多 IDE(整合開發環境)支援文件註解。當你在 IDE 中呼叫函數時,文件註解會提供智慧提示,顯示函數的可用參數和回傳值。它還可以提供自動補全,幫助你加快開發速度。

3. 可測試性

文件註解可以作為測試案例基礎。透過驗證文件中指定的預期輸入和輸出,你可以確保函數的行為符合要求。

4. 實戰案例

以下程式碼範例示範如何在PHP 函數中加入文件註解:

/**
 * 计算两数的总和
 *
 * @param int $number1 第一个数字
 * @param int $number2 第二个数字
 * @return int 两个数字的总和
 */
function sum(int $number1, int $number2): int
{
    return $number1 + $number2;
}

如你所見,文件註解以三個斜槓(

/**) 開頭,並以三個星號 (***/) 結束。中間的文本分行組織,每一行描述函數的不同面向。 IDE 現在會顯示此函數的智慧提示,如下所示:

function sum(int $number1, int $number2): int

以上是為自訂 PHP 函數新增文件註解有什麼好處?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n